Kenneth Fogel commented on NETBEANS-2959: ----------------------------------------- Sorry, it does not work. I tried a few of the samples for a New Project from Samples/JavaFX and I received the following error and the project could not be created. I'm using Java 12. "The JDK you are using does not support JavaFX.."
